Embarking on the Base Walk around Uluru was one of the most deeply spiritual experiences of my journey. There’s something profoundly moving about walking the full 10-kilometer circuit, connecting with the rock's ancient stories and absorbing its energy. The trail is mostly flat and well-marked, making it accessible, but definitely come prepared with plenty of water to keep you refreshed.

If the whole 10 kilometers feels a bit much, don’t stress! You can choose to explore specific sections of the walk based on your time, fitness level, or weather conditions. Highlights like Wave Rock, the Kuniya Walk, and the serene Mutitjulu Waterhole are must-sees, each offering its own unique perspective and beauty. This walk is the perfect opportunity to truly immerse yourself in the heart of the Australian Outback.
